A football player punts a ball. The path of the ball can be modeled by the equation y = –0.004x2 + x + 2.5, where x is the horizontal distance, in feet, the ball travels and y is the height, in feet, of the ball. How far from the football player will the ball land? Round to the nearest tenth of a foot. 125.0 ft 127.5 ft 247.5 ft 252.5 ft

solve with quadratic formula or graph and calculate the right hand zero
0=–0.004x2 + x + 2.5 x=-2.475 x=252.5 distance cant be negative, so the 2nd must be the logical answer. as it happens this is D.
